Tabung Haji to increase haj subsidy by RM40mil next year


KUALA LUMPUR: Tabung Haji (Pilgrimage Fund Board) will spend RM200mil to subsidise pilgrims next year compared to RM160mil this year.

Prime Minister Datuk Seri Najib Tun Razak said the subsidy was part of the government's effort to maintain and uphold the grandeur of Islam in Malaysia and help Muslims to perform the fifth pillar of Islam.
